Description
A quiet street in Hollomstown, with much of the pavement removed.
History
Adolphy Drive was a quiet road, commissioned in the 1960s by the Malton City Council. Much of its pavement has been broken away since the outbreak in 2005, as a result of survivors looking for materials to build their barricades with.
Barricading policy
This is an empty block, and cannot be barricaded.
